Minutes — Management Meeting, Subscription Tier Review

Present: Heads of Department. Chair: D. Ashgrove.

The committee reviewed the proposed Heliotrope Select tier in detail. Pricing assumptions were examined against churn projections, and Product confirmed the feature set is feasible within the current release cycle. Marketing will prepare a phased announcement plan for sign-off. Finance raised margin questions, to be resolved before launch approval. The chair then recorded the following confidential note on forward plans.

management briefing: Project Ulavan slips by two quarters because of the staffing delay.

TURN-208: Gatevale turnstile counters at the Merrow Field pilot double-count when a rotation reverses mid-cycle. Attendance totals drift roughly 2% high per event. The debounce window fix is implemented, reviewed by Ilsa, and soak-tested across two simulated match days without drift. Ready for your cut; the candidate build is identified below.

trace token, tagag-tafog: htk6_5ed18c

== Transport: Safe Replacement Lock ==

The replacement lock for the Harnsby office safe ships as a single sealed parcel from Quillard Lockworks. Dispatch must treat it as controlled hardware: no overnight storage on the open dock, signature required at both ends. The fitting appointment depends on same-day arrival, so release it to the first scheduled courier only. The courier must be given the hand-over phrase stated below.

handover note for yagef-bagep: the drudor pelius courier leaves the kasdor zorvan norir ledger at gate 8016 under passcode 755406

## Authentication

Scrutineer (the audit-log viewer) talks to the Varnhold record service over mTLS plus a static key. Certs are already baked into the dev container. Do not reuse this key outside the sandbox tier; it is scoped read-only. For local runs, set the environment variable to the key below.

service key, bajep-hahig: zpat15_8GdlyV2kd9BCqYH